About Dunfermline

Dunfermline is a village in Fulton County, Illinois, United States. The 2020 census counted 262 residents. Dunfermline is pronounced Done-ferm-lin. A post office has been in operation at Dunfermline since 1887. A share of the first settlers being natives of Dunfermline, Scotland, caused the name to be selected. Dunfermline is located in east-central Fulton County. Illinois Route 78 forms the eastern border of the village; the highway leads north 5 miles to Canton and south 6 miles to U.S. Route 24 at Little America.
